List Of Courses That Are In Demand In South Africa
South Africa’s job market continues to face skill shortages in key sectors such as cybersecurity, artificial intelligence, data science & analytics, and business administration. As industries adapt to the digital & artificial intelligence era, global competition, and changing regulations, employers are increasingly seeking graduates with specialised and future-ready skills.
High-demand programmes are closely linked to roles that support innovation, operational efficiency, and economic development. These fields offer students stronger employment prospects and faster career progression, making them attractive options for those planning their studies.
By enrolling in these programmes, students gain practical and relevant knowledge that prepares them for real-world workplace challenges. They also develop transferable skills that allow them to work across industries and adapt as the job market evolves.
Some high-demand programmes in South Africa include:
- Data Science and Analytics: This programme uses statistics, coding, and smart tech to extract useful information from large data sets.
-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ning: In this artificial intelligence programme, students learn how to create programmes that help machines learn and make decisions independently.
- Cybersecurity: This programme focuses on how to protect computers and networks from online threats and hackers.
- Software Development: This programme can help you gain skills in creating, testing, and maintaining software for different platforms.
- Project Management: In this programme, you learn to plan, execute, and oversee projects while managing resources and deadlines.

Online Courses In South Africa
Online learning has made education more accessible by allowing people to study at their own pace and from anywhere. In South Africa, this flexible approach to learning has grown in popularity as it reflects current job market demands.
Many students choose online programmes because they can manage their time better and balance work, family responsibilities, and education. These programmes are especially beneficial for working professionals who want to upgrade their skills without leaving their jobs.
Online programmes that align with industry needs offer the same value as traditional classroom learning. They focus on practical skills, real-world applications, and current market trends. As more employers recognise online qualifications, studying online has become a smart and flexible way to build a successful career in the current competitive job market.
Some online courses that are in demand in South Africa include:
- Digital Marketing: As more businesses go online, a Digital Marketing Course is highly valued because it provides knowledge of digital marketing strategies.
- Graphic Design: In this programme, you will study visual communication and design principles using software tools to create compelling graphics.
- Data Analysis: With the rise of big data, Data Analysis courses teach professionals to analyse and interpret data.
- Business Administration: This programme covers key management principles and practices and prepares students for various business roles.
- Information Technology: Online IT programme offers flexible learning options for students interested in tech careers.

Which job will be replaced by AI?
Jobs that involve repetitive, rule-based tasks such as basic data entry, routine customer support, and simple administrative roles are most likely to be replaced or heavily automated by AI.
